LUNA, Apayao – As means to foster respect and love for one’s province, a memorandum was released by the Schools Division of Apayao (Division Memorandum No. 339 S. 2023 or also known as the Proper hand gesture during the singing of the Apayao Provincial Hymn-Apayao) to set the guidelines to be followed.
Irene S. Angway PhD, CESO V, Schools Division Superintendent, signed said memorandum last September 11, 2023 which she said was based on a provincial legislation (Provincial Ordinance No. 13, S. 2020.) The ordinance is titled “An Ordinance Institutionalizing a Proper Hand Gesture during the Singing of the Apayao Provincial Hymn- Apayao Forever.”
Angway advised all employees of the Apayao Schools Division Office, including students, to introduce or institutionalize the proper hand gesture and careful upholding of some virtues while singing the Apayao Provincial Hymn in all public occasions.
It was stated in section 5 of said ordinance that the Apayao Provincial Hymn should be sung with the thumb at a 45-degrees angle from the closed/gripped four fingers.
According to the explicit instructions in the Ordinance of Virtues the following must also be observed: Hat/ Umbrella off; Stand at attention and face the conductor; No unnecessary body movements; No hands-on-pocket; No use of cell-phones must be in off mode; and Moving individuals/vehicles must stop.
The ordinance’s goals are to give all yApayaos a chance to express their love and respect for their Apayao and to recognize its distinctive culture while preserving the sincere and in-depth meaning of patriotism, self-esteem, respect, unity and solidarity, integrity, loyalty, and harmony.
